Sarah is an African American woman who was the oldest and only girl of four children. She grew up in Del Paso Heights, a community on the outskirts of Sacramento, California. In her childhood, during the late 1940s and 1950s, challenges of racism and poverty negatively impacted her household which made Sarah's growing up years full of fear from emotional and physical abuse. Unconsciously, Sarah developed coping skills that helped her psychologically escape from the turmoil of her environment. In her mid-thirties life became safe enough to begin a long process of uncovering the pain brought on by the previous years of abuse. As she healed and developed insights, she began to help others heal. As a successful life and career coach, Sarah has helped hundreds of people overcome their fears to live their best life. She currently lives in northern Arizona with her husband, Ed, and their Shih-tzu doggie, Sam.
